var min=8;
var max=18;

function increaseFontSize() {
   var p = document.getElementsByTagName('p');
   for(i=0;i<p.length;i++) {
      if(p[i].style.fontSize) {
         var s = parseInt(p[i].style.fontSize.replace("px",""));
      } else {
         var s = 12;
      }
      if(s!=max) {
         s += 1;
      }
      p[i].style.fontSize = s+"px"
   }
}

function decreaseFontSize() {
   var p = document.getElementsByTagName('p');
   for(i=0;i<p.length;i++) {
      if(p[i].style.fontSize) {
         var s = parseInt(p[i].style.fontSize.replace("px",""));
      } else {
         var s = 12;
      }
      if(s!=min) {
         s -= 1;
      }
      p[i].style.fontSize = s+"px"
   }   
}

function addToShop(id){
	dojo.io.bind({
		url: "addToShop.php?activityId="+id,
		method: "get",
		load: function(type,data,evt) {
			if(data) {
				document.getElementById("addToShop").innerHTML = data;
			}else
				document.getElementById("addToShop").innerHTML = "Added to shop";
		},
		error: function(type, error) {
			;
		},
		mimetype: "text/html"
	});
}

function removeFromShop(id){
	removeFromShop(id, 0);
}

function removeFromShop(id, reload){
	dojo.io.bind({
		url: "removeFromShop.php?activityId="+id,
		method: "get",
		load: function(type,data,evt) {
			if( reload )
				window.location.reload( true );
			else
				document.getElementById("addToShop").innerHTML = addToShop(0);
		},
		error: function(type, error) {
			;
		},
		mimetype: "text/html"
	});
}

function showPictures(id){
	showPictures(id, 0);
}

function showPictures(id, position){
	dojo.io.bind({
		url: "showPictureAlbum.php?refId="+id+"&position="+position,
		method: "get",
		load: function(type,data,evt) {
			document.getElementById("popupplace").innerHTML = data;
		},
		error: function(type, error) {
			;
		},
		mimetype: "text/html"
		});
}

function showActivityPictures(id, position){
	dojo.io.bind({
		url: "showActivityPictureAlbum.php?activityId="+id+"&position="+position,
		method: "get",
		load: function(type,data,evt) {
			document.getElementById("popupplace").innerHTML = data;
		},
		error: function(type, error) {
			;
		},
		mimetype: "text/html"
		});
}
function showPicture(url){
	showPicture(url, 'Foto', '');
}

function showPicture(url, title, description){
	dojo.io.bind({
		url: "showPicture.php?url="+url+"&title="+title+"&descr="+description,
		method: "get",
		load: function(type,data,evt) {
			document.getElementById("popupplace").innerHTML = data;
		},
		error: function(type, error) {
			;
		},
		mimetype: "text/html"
		});
}

function showPictureMaxSize(url, title, description){
	dojo.io.bind({
		url: "showPictureMaxSize.php?url="+url+"&title="+title+"&descr="+description,
		method: "get",
		load: function(type,data,evt) {
			document.getElementById("popupplace").innerHTML = data;
		},
		error: function(type, error) {
			;
		},
		mimetype: "text/html"
		});
}

function showBigImage(url){
	document.getElementById("bigimage").innerHTML = "<img src=\""+url+"\" style=\"max-width:540px; max-height:500px;\"/>";
}

function closePopup() {
	document.getElementById("popup").style.visibility = "hidden";
}